Canon SX230 HS vs FujiFilm JZ300 Overview

Below, we will be analyzing the Canon SX230 HS and FujiFilm JZ300, former being a Small Sensor Superzoom while the latter is a Small Sensor Compact by rivals Canon and FujiFilm. The image resolution of the SX230 HS (12MP) and the JZ300 (12MP) is relatively similar and they feature the exact same sensor size (1/2.3").

Canon SX230 HS vs FujiFilm JZ300 Physical Comparison

For anyone who is going to carry your camera often, you will need to consider its weight and proportions. The Canon SX230 HS comes with physical dimensions of 106mm x 62mm x 33mm (4.2" x 2.4" x 1.3") having a weight of 223 grams (0.49 lbs) while the FujiFilm JZ300 has measurements of 97mm x 57mm x 29m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 1.1") having a weight of 168 grams (0.37 lbs).

Canon SX230 HS vs FujiFilm JZ300 Sensor Comparison

Quite often, it is tough to picture the difference between sensor sizing only by reading technical specs. The photograph here will give you a clearer sense of the sensor sizes in the SX230 HS and JZ300.

As you can tell, the two cameras posses the exact same sensor measurements and the identical megapixels and you can expect similar quality of images but you would want to factor the age of the products into consideration. The fresher SX230 HS provides a benefit in sensor technology.
